The Frosty Frontier: When Does Austin Experience Its Lowest Temps?
If you thought Austin was all about sunny skies and barbecue, think again. The coldest months in Austin typically fall between December and February, with January often taking the crown as the chilliest. During this period, average temperatures can dip into the 40s (Fahrenheit), and if you’re unlucky, you might even catch a rare snowfall that turns the city into a winter wonderland. 🌨️🌨️
But don’t pack your parkas just yet! While the mercury may drop, Austin’s mild winters mean that sub-freezing temperatures are relatively rare. Most of the time, it’s just a matter of bundling up in your favorite flannel and enjoying the cozy vibes of a Texan winter.
